This specialization equips you with a deep understanding of JavaScript fundamentals, asynchronous programming, and practical problem-solving skills. By the end, you will have the confidence to write sophisticated code and tackle challenging developer interviews.

Discover new skills with 30% off courses from industry experts. Save now.


Become a JavaScript Developer Specialization
The Ultimate JavaScript Journey. Essentials, Deep Dive & Beyond



Instructors: Per Harald Borgen
2,570 already enrolled
Included with
(69 reviews)
(69 reviews)
What you'll learn
Develop interactive and dynamic web applications using JavaScript
Integrate front-end applications with backend databases using Firebase, ensuring data is synchronized and persistent across user sessions.
Deploy a browser extensions for Chrome, equipping you with the ability to create tools that enhance browser functionality and improve user workflows.
Overview
Skills you'll gain
Tools you'll learn
What’s included

Add to your LinkedIn profile
March 2025
Advance your subject-matter expertise
- Learn in-demand skills from university and industry experts
- Master a subject or tool with hands-on projects
- Develop a deep understanding of key concepts
- Earn a career certificate from Scrimba

Specialization - 4 course series
What you'll learn
How the JavaScript programming language works, all the way from the basics to the advanced concepts
Basic computer science concepts including variables, data types, functions, conditionals, loops, and much more.
How to build real-world web apps using the JavaScript programming language
Skills you'll gain
What you'll learn
JavaScript
Tech interview practice
Skills you'll gain
What you'll learn
Create efficient functions using arrow syntax and expressions.
Apply array methods like .map() and .reduce() to process data.
Debug JavaScript applications using common error-handling techniques.
Skills you'll gain
What you'll learn
A solid understanding of the fundamentals of TypeScript.
How to leverage TypeScript to create safer and more reliable JavaScript applications.
Skills you'll gain
Earn a career certificate
Add this credential to your LinkedIn profile, resume, or CV. Share it on social media and in your performance review.
Instructors



Offered by
Why people choose Coursera for their career





Open new doors with Coursera Plus
Unlimited access to 10,000+ world-class courses, hands-on projects, and job-ready certificate programs - all included in your subscription
Advance your career with an online degree
Earn a degree from world-class universities - 100% online
Join over 3,400 global companies that choose Coursera for Business
Upskill your employees to excel in the digital economy
Frequently asked questions
The runtime for the videos is around 30 hours, but expect to spend at least three times as long, as the course is filled with interactive coding challenges and projects.
Basic understanding of HTML and CSS is recommended but not mandatory
No, you can jump around but we recommend you to follow the order.
More questions
Financial aid available,